Prosecutor's mysterious death gets renewed attention after coroner's records found
The federal prosecutor was found dead in a creek on Dec. 4, 2003, stabbed 36 times and with his throat slit. His death remains ruled a homicide, but federal investigators believe he committed suicide.

Man charged with murder in double shooting at Perkins Homes
Gary Watkins, 54, has been charged with first-degree murder in the Friday shooting, which killed Devante Smith, 25, and injured a 23-year-old woman.
